Tulips continue to grow and can curve in the vase, which many customers love as part of their natural character. For longer life, they need plenty of fresh water, a clean vase, re-cut stems, and a cool position away from direct sunlight.

Dahlias can be strong in late summer and early autumn, so March often brings good options, although weekly conditions vary by grower. For those comparing peonies, tulips, dahlias, dahlias can offer standout impact even when other premium stems are limited.
Popular searches include dahlias, dahlia flowers, dahlias Australia, and buy dahlias, especially for bright statement colours. When buying in person or selecting from photos, customers should look for firm petals, strong necks with no droop, and healthy foliage.
Dahlia sizes and shapes can also guide the purchase: smaller, tighter forms suit gifting, while large dinner-plate styles shine in big arrangements. For a contemporary look, dahlias work as focal blooms with lighter supporting stems or with blue flowers as contrast in modern palettes.

Longevity in late summer comes down to sturdy stems, heat tolerance, and correct care. As a general guide, dahlias often perform well with proper hydration, tulips can be shorter-lived in warmth, and peonies can last well if kept cool, making peonies, tulips, dahlias a useful âchoose by conditionsâ shortlist.
